Output 38440181bda208f617a4ce5961248611cc5590ec47f20882ef7f3de4b14c81f4:0

value
404000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2a3ab368f72153c9c430aae092d73b71a3bf40dc OP_EQUALVERIFY OP_CHECKSIG
address
14rHhfMtSRPQaf42nEptcNAdWMbX9mcwhy
transaction
38440181bda208f617a4ce5961248611cc5590ec47f20882ef7f3de4b14c81f4
confirmations
534383
spent
true